Geo Location Information for 58.251.94.82 IP Address. The IP Address 58.251.94.82 is located at 22.5455 latitude and 114.068 longitude in China. Friendly Location for the IP Address is Guangdong, Shenzhen, China, 518026
华风商务站通过为会员提供免费店铺、展示供应产品信息、传递精选电商经验等服务,帮助全国中小企业开展b2b电子商务。是一个有特色的b2b电子商务平台。